IOC accepts Thomas Bach's resignation as head of the organization
27.02.2025 | 04:47 |The International Olympic Committee (IOC) has accepted Thomas Bach's resignation as president of the organization.
The decision will come into effect after June 23, when the powers will be transferred to the new head of the IOC.
The election of the new head of the organization will be held as part of the IOC session from March 18 to 21, 2025. The event will be held in Athens (Greece). Seven people are vying for the post of IOC head. The list includes: Faisal Al-Hussein (Jordan), Sebastian Coe (Great Britain), Kirsty Coventry (Zimbabwe), Juan Antonio Samaranch Jr. (Spain), Johan Elias (Sweden), David Lapartian (France), Morinari Watanabe (Japan). Bach said that he will not seek re-election for another term.
In August 2024, Thomas Bach announced that he would step down at the end of his term. He led the IOC for more than 10 years, since 2013.
